حساب أقل مسافة تكلفة لكل خلية من مصدر أقل تكلفة أو إليها، في حين حساب مسافة السطح بجانب عوامل التكلفة الأفقية والرأسية.
هذه دالة بيانات نقطية عامة.
ملاحظات
تتم مقارنة دوال "مسافة المسار" بدوال "مسافة التكلفة" في أنهما تحددان أقل تكلفة تراكمية للسفر من أو إلى مصدر لكل موقع على سطح بيانات نقطية. ومع ذلك، تقوم دوال مسافة المسار بإضافة مزيد من التعقيد إلى التحليل باستيعاب مسافة السطح الفعلية وكذلك العوامل الأفقية والرأسية الأخرى.
تعمل الخلايا ذات NoData كحواجز في دوال Path Distance. يتم حساب مسافة تكلفة الخلايا خلف قيم NoData بواسطة التكلفة التراكمية اللازمة لتحريك حاجز NoData. ستتلقى كل مواقع الخلية التي تم تعيين NoData لأي من البيانات النقطية المدخلة NoData في كل البيانات النقطية الناتجة.
يتم تحديد أقصى مسافة في نفس وحدة التكلفة على أنها البيانات النقطية للتكلفة.
في البيانات النقطية الناتجة، تعد مسافة أقل تكلفة (أو أدنى مسافة تكلفة تراكمية) للخلية لمجموعة من مواقع المصدر أقل حدود للمسافات الأقل تكلفة من الخلية إلى كل المواقع المصدر.
فيما يلي القيم الافتراضية لمُعدِّلات العامل الأفقي:
Keywords Zero factor Cut angle Slope Side value -------------- ----------- ----------- ----- --------- Binary 1.0 45 ~ ~ Forward 0.5 45 (fixed) ~ 1.0 Linear 0.5 181 1/90 ~ Inverse linear 2.0 180 -1/90 ~
فيما يلي القيم الافتراضية لمُعدِّلات العامل الرأسي:
Keyword Zero Low High Slope Power Cos Sec factor cut cut power power angle angle ------------------------ ------ ----- ----- ----- ----- ----- ----- Binary 1.0 -30 30 ~ ~ ~ ~ Linear 1.0 -90 90 1/90 ~ ~ ~ Symmetric linear 1.0 -90 90 1/90 ~ ~ ~ Inverse linear 1.0 -45 45 -1/45 ~ ~ ~ Symmetric inverse linear 1.0 -45 45 -1/45 ~ ~ ~ Cos ~ -90 90 ~ 1.0 ~ ~ Sec ~ -90 90 ~ 1.0 ~ ~ Cos_sec ~ -90 90 ~ ~ 1.0 1.0 Sec_cos ~ -90 90 ~ ~ 1.0 1.0 Hiking time ~ -70 70 ~ ~ ~ ~ Bidirectional hiking time ~ -70 70 ~ ~ ~ ~
يمكن استخدام إخراج دالة العرض إلى الارتفاع (Aspect) كإدخال لمعلمة للبيانات النقطية الأفقية.
يمكن التحكم في خصائص المصدر أو المحركات من أو إلى مصدر ما، بواسطة معلمات محددة. تُحدد معلمة مُضاعِف تكلفة المصدر وضع السفر أو المقدار في المصدر، وتقوم تكلفة بدء المصدر بتعيين تكلفة البداية قبل الانتقال مجددًا، كما يعد معدل مقاومة المصدر حساب ضبط ديناميكي لتأثير التكلفة المتراكمة، مثل محاكاة كيفية شعور المسافر بالتعب، فيما تقوم سعة المصدر بتعيين التكلفة التي يمكن للمصدر ترتيبها قبل وصول الحد الخاص به. يُعرَّف اتجاه السفر ما إذا كان المُحرِّك يبدأ عند مصدر وينتقل إلى مواقع ليست مصدر، أو يبدأ عند مواقع ليس مصدر وينتقل إلى مصدر.
إذا تم تحديد أي من معلمات خصائص المصدر باستخدام حقل، سيتم تطبيق خاصية المصدر على أساس مصدر بواسطة مصدر، وفقًا للمعلومات في الحقل المحدد للبيانات المصدر. عند تحديد مفتاح أساسي أو قيمة ثابتة، سيتم تطبيقه/تطبيقها على كل المصادر.
إذا تم تحديد تكلفة بدء المصدر، فسيتم تعيين مواقع المصدر على سطح مسافة التكلفة الناتجة إلى قيمة تكلفة بدء المصدر؛ وإلا، سيتم تعيين المواقع المصدر إلى سطح مسافة التكلفة الناتجة إلى صفر.
المعلمات
اسم المعلمة | الوصف |
---|---|
البيانات النقطية للمصدر (مطلوب) | مواقع المصدر المدخلة. إنها مجموعة بيانات نقطية تقوم بتعريف الخلايا أو المواقع التي يتم حساب مسافة أقل تكلفة تراكمية لكل موقع خلية ناتج منها أو إليها. ويمكن أن تكون عددًا صحيحًا أو نوع نقطة عائمة. |
البيانات النقطية للتكلفة (مطلوب) | بيانات نقطية تُعرّف التكلفة أو المعاوقة المطلوب نقلهما عبر كل خلية بشكل مسطح. تمثل القيمة في كل موقع خلية مسافة "التكلفة لكل وحدة" للتنقل خلالها. يتم ضرب كل قيمة موقع خلية في دقة الخلية، وهو يُعوِّض أيضًا التحرُّك المائل للحصول على التكلفة الإجمالية للتمرير خلال الخلية. يمكن أن تكون قيم البيانات النقطية للتكلفة عددًا صحيحًا أو نقطة عائمة، ولكنها لا يمكن أن تكون سالبة أو صفرًا. |
البيانات النقطية للسطح | بيانات نقطية تحدد قيم المسقط الرأسي لكل موقع خلية. يتم استخدام القيم لحساب مسافة السطح الفعلي المُغطَّى عند التمرير بين الخلايا. |
البيانات النقطية الأفقية | بيانات نقطية تحدد الاتجاه الرأسي عند كل خلية. يجب أن تكوت القيم في البيانات النقطية أعدادًا صحيحة تتراوح من 0 إلى 360، بـ 0 درجة شمالاً أو تجاه أعلى الشاشة، والتزايد في اتجاه عقارب الساعة. يجب أن تحصيل المناطق المستوية على قيمة -1. سيتم استخدام القيم في كل موقع بالاقتران مع معلمة المعامل الأفقي لتحديد التكلفة الأفقية التي حدثت عند الانتقال من خلية إلى ما يجاورها. |
المعامل الأفقي | تعريف العلاقة بين معامل التكلفة الأفقي وزاوية الحركة النسبية الأفقية (HRMA). توجد معاملات عديدة بمعدلات تتعرف على رسم بياني لمعامل رأسي مُعرَّف. بالإضافة إلى ذلك، يمكن استخدام جدول لإنشاء رسم بياني مخصص. تستخدم الرسوم البيانية لتحديد العامل الرأسي المستخدم في احتساب إجمالي التكلفة للتحرك في الخلية المجاورة. في التوضيحات أدناه، يتم استخدام الاختصارين: HF وHRMA. يشير HF إلى العامل الأفقي، والذي يحدد الصعوبة الأفقية التي تتم مواجهتها عند التحرك من خلية إلى الخلية التالية. يشير HRMA إلى زاوية الحركة النسبية الأفقية، والتي تحدد الزاوية بين الاتجاه الأفقي من خلية واتجاه الحركة. تشمل أنواع المعالم الأفقي ما يلي:
تشمل مُعدِّلات المعاملات الأفقية ما يلي:
|
البيانات النقطية الرأسية | يحدد العلاقة بين عامل التكلفة الرأسي وزاوية الحركة الرأسية ذات الصلة (VRMA). تستخدم القيم لاحتساب الميل (المنحدر) المستخدم لتحديد العامل الرأسي الذي يحدث عند نقله من خلية لأخرى. |
المعامل الرأسي | يحدد العلاقة بين عامل التكلفة الرأسي وزاوية الحركة الرأسية ذات الصلة (VRMA). توجد معاملات عديدة بمعدلات تتعرف على رسم بياني لمعامل رأسي مُعرَّف. بالإضافة إلى ذلك، يمكن استخدام جدول لإنشاء رسم بياني مخصص. تستخدم الرسوم البيانية لتحديد العامل الرأسي المستخدم في احتساب إجمالي التكلفة للتحرك في الخلية المجاورة. في التوضيحات أدناه، يتم استخدام الاختصارين: VF وVRMA. يشير VF إلى العامل الرأسي، والذي يحدد الصعوبة الرأسية التي تتم مواجهتها عند التحرك من خلية إلى الخلية التالية. يشير VRMA إلى زاوية الحركة النسبية الرأسية، والتي تحدد زاوية الميل بين خلية FROM، أو المعالجة، وخلية TO. العامل الرأسي تشير الأنواع إلى ما يلي:
تشمل المعدلات للكلمات الرئيسية الرأسية ما يلي:
|
المسافة القصوى | الحد الذي يتعذر على قيم التكلفة التراكمية تجاوزه. إذا تجاوزت مسافة التكلفة المتراكمة هذه القيمة، ستكون قيمة الإخراج لموقع الخلية NoData. تُعرّف أقصى مسافة النطاق الذي تم حساب مسافات التكلفة التراكمية له. المسافة الافتراضية حتى نطاق البيانات النقطية الناتجة. |
المُضاعِف للتطبيق على التكاليف | المضاعف الذي سوف يُطبق لقيم التكلفة. تتيح هذه المعلمة التحكم في وضع السفر أو المقدار في المصدر. كلما زاد المُضاعِف، زادت تكلفة التنقل خلال كل بكسل. يجب أن تكون القيم أكبر من صفر. القيمة الافتراضية هي 1. يمكن استخدام قيمة رقمية (مزدوجة) أو حقل من البيانات النقطية المصدر لهذه المعلمة. |
بدء التكلفة | تكلفة البداية التي سيتم استخدامها لبدء حسابات التكلفة. تتيح لك هذه المعلمة تحديد التكلفة الثابتة المرتبطة بالمصدر. بدلاً من البدء بتكلفة بقيمة 0، سيبدأ لوغاريتم التكلفة بالقيمة المحددة. يجب أن تكون القيمة صفرًا أو أكبر. القيمة الافتراضية هي 0. |
معدل مقاومة التكلفة التراكمي | تُحاكي هذه المعلمة زيادة المجهود للتغلب على التكاليف في ظل ازدياد التكلفة التراكمية. وتُستَخدَم لنمذجة التعب الذي يشعر به المسافر. تتضاعف التكلفة التراكمية المتزايدة للوصول إلى خلية بواسطة معدل المقاومة وإضافتها إلى التكلفة للانتقال إلى الخلية التالية. إنه إصدار مُعدّل لصيغة نسبة فوائد مركبة تستخدم لحساب التكلفة الظاهرة للانتقال عبر خلية. في حين بلغت قيمة الزيادات معدل المقاومة، فإنه يزيد من تكلفة الخلايا التي يتم زيارتها في وقت لاحق. كلما زادت نسبة المقاومة، زادت تكلفة الوصول إلى الخلية التالية، والذي تم تركيبه لكل انتقال تالٍ. ونظرًا لأن نسبة المقاومة مشابهة لنسبة مركبة، وتكون قيم التكلفة التراكمية كبيرة للغاية بشكل عام، يتم اقتراح نسب مقاومة صغيرة، مثل 0.005 أو أصغر، وذلك وفقًا لقيم التكلفة التراكمية. يجب أن تكون القيمة أكبر من صفر. السعة الافتراضية تكون نحو حافة البيانات النقطية الناتجة. |
السعة | تعريف سعة التكلفة للمسافر والمتعلقة بالمصدر. تستمر حسابات التكلفة لكل مصدر حتى يتم الوصول إلى السعة المحددة. يجب أن تكون القيمة أكبر من صفر. السعة الافتراضية تكون نحو حافة البيانات النقطية الناتجة. |
اتجاه السفر | تعريف اتجاه المسافر عند تطبيق نسبة مقاومة المصدر.
حدد الكلمة الرئيسية من مصدر أو إلى مصدر والتي ستُطبّق على كل المصادر أو حدد حقلاً في البيانات النقطية المصدر التي تحتوي على الكلمات الرئيسية لتعريف اتجاه السفر لكل مصدر. يجب أن يحتوي هذا الحقل على السلسلة FROM_SOURCE أو TO_SOURCE. |